Soap-Dispensing Scrub Brush
Amazon
If this isn’t the perfect cleaning tool, then we don’t know what is. OXO thought of everything when it attached a bristled head to a hollow handle. Instead of struggling with a wet, slippery soap bottle, you can pre-fill the handle with soap and dispense it at the touch of a button while washing dishes. Shoppers say they’ll “never go back” to sponges now that they own this brush — in fact, it “actually makes me want to hand wash my dishes,” said one owner.

Apple Corer
Amazon
Apple season is upon us. Whether you’re making apple pie or apple fritters, you’re going to want to have this apple corer on hand. While it’s easy to cut an apple away from its core with a paring knife, this clever gadget keeps the shape of the fruit intact for prettier desserts, salads, and more. It also works on pears.
Cut and Serve Turner
Amazon
This clever turner keeps you from dirtying a knife and a spoon when serving lasagnas, stratas, brownies, and more. This is in large part thanks to its sharp edge, which cuts through a layer of broiled cheese as easily as it breaks through a crackly chocolate crust. The edge is also beveled to help slide under and lift up food.
